Suit Seeks Publication Of Names, Pictures Of Mayor’s Gay Chat Buddies
by The Associated Press(Spokane, Washington) The Spokesman-Review newspaper is asking a judge to rethink his decision not to allow the release of photographs — from a gay Web site — found on the city-owned laptop computer of recalled Mayor James E. West.
…
What possible valid reason could have for needing the names and pictures of the people this Mayor was talking to? While the people who have profiles on Gay.COM surely don’t expect absolute privacy when posting a profile to a site like this, i’m sure many weren’t aware they were talking to a public figure and regardless none would have expected to be part of the public record…
Smacks of a witch hunt to me… ‘Are you or are anyone you know now, or have ever been, a member of the homosexual party’….
